3. Cushioning and Impact Absorption
Running outdoors on concrete can take a heavy toll on joints. A quality home treadmill uk features shock-absorption technology that minimizes impact by up to 15% to 40% compared to road running, safeguarding knees, ankles, and hips.
4. Area and Foldability
Area is frequently the greatest restraint in a home fitness center. Purchasers should measure their available flooring space, including ceiling height (do not forget to represent the user's height plus the incline height). Folding treadmills with hydraulic help systems are perfect for multi-use spaces.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)1. Just how much space do I require for a home treadmill?
Typically, you must leave at least 2 feet of clearance on either side of the treadmill and 6 feet of clearance behind it for safety in case of a journey or fall. Ceiling height ought to be computed by taking your height, including the optimum height of the treadmill deck plus slope, and making sure there is still at least one foot of clearance above your head.
2. Are manual curved treadmills much better than motorized ones?
Manual curved treadmills uk do not have motors; the user's own stride powers the belt. They are extraordinary for High-Intensity Interval Training (HIIT) and promote a more natural running kind. Nevertheless, they are generally more expensive, do not feature motorized inclines, and need active effort even simply to keep a sluggish walk. Motorized treadmills are better matched for traditional steady-state running and walking.
3. Do I need a subscription to use a wise treadmill?
No. While brand names like NordicTrack, ProForm, and Peloton greatly promote their membership services (which use picturesque routes, live classes, and automatic trainer control), the majority of smart treadmills can be used in "Manual Mode" without paying for a monthly subscription.
4. How long do home treadmills typically last?
With appropriate upkeep and regular lubrication, a quality home treadmill will last between 7 to 12 years. High-end commercial-grade designs can easily last 15 years or more. Picking buy a treadmill reliable brand with a strong warranty (life time on frame and motor, 2-- 5 years on parts) is the finest indicator of expected longevity.
